Pig Pickin’ entertainment announced

By September 24, 2014Alumni

Each year, one of the biggest components of the Pig Pickin’ atmosphere is the entertainment. The 29th annual Pig Pickin’ will feature a variety of entertainment for Friday and Saturday.

Friday night’s entertainment will kick off with the local Cleveland trio Southern Halo at 9:15 p.m. following the Cleveland High School versus East Side High School crosstown rivalry football game at Parker Field McCool Stadium. As soon as the game ends, sisters Natalia, Christina and Hannah will perform a variety of blues, southern rock and pop country hits.

Saturday’s entertainment will be provided by the Delta Music Institute bands Ol’ Skool Revue and DeltaRoX. Ol’ Skool Revue is comprised of Delta State students and faculty, playing hits from the blues, R&B, soul and funk genres. DeltaRoX also consists of Delta State students and faculty and focuses on classic rock. There will also be a DJ in the park and a live radio broadcast from Jim Gregory. The Fighting Okra and Statesmen mascots will be signing autographs and taking pictures at the Legacy Tent.

The Cheerleaders will lead a pep rally at 3 p.m. featuring the Delta State band and football players. At 5 p.m., the winners of the BBQ cook team competition will be announced. The 26 teams competing this year will add to the atmosphere that continues to grow at Statesmen Park.
